Our Stephen Ministry team is preparing for the privilege of entering into active caring ministry; walking with people going through the normal crises of life, through changes and losses where we just need someone to stay and listen for a while.  We will soon be matching our Stephen Ministers with care receivers.  If you are in need of a Stephen Minister or would like to know more about this ministry, please contact me at This email address is being protected from spambots. We have begun a study of God's servant, Moses, liberating and teaching God's people.  We will observe his growth in stature and prominence in Pharaoh's household, his awakening to his Hebrew roots, lessons learned from failure, and the humilty he learned as a servant leader under the mercy of God.  Join us for this Bible Study in the chapel each Sunday at 9:45am.
